Players who've been eager to play but haven't felt like parting with their cash just yet are in luck because the game will soon be free to play. Launching in late 2023, the remastered version of the popular may not have established itself as a powerhouse in the genre like its older iteration, but the game still boasts a dedicated community. While the price for entry is still fairly steep, those who want to understand why the game is so beloved and hated in equal measure can now do so without spending a cent.
Over on Steam, developer Studio Wildcard announced that will be hosting a free weekend on PC where interested players can check it out for free until April 7. There's no restriction on how long can be spent in-game, meaning with some dedication and a healthy amount of time, a dedicated consumer could see the bulk of what's on offer if they play for the whole weekend. To make the deal sweeter, is also on sale for 20% off its usual price so those who enjoy the trial can continue playing once Monday rolls around.
To make matters even better, has also just launched the expansion which features the voice talents of Karl Urban and Auliʻi Cravalho. The add-one chronicles the adventures of the titular Bob across The Island, Scorched Earth, Aberration, and Extinction and includes several new creatures and vehicles, including an Oasisaur and a train. Additionally, players can also unlock skins inspired by , including Helena, Bob, Dodo, and Scary the Parasaur.
The franchise is so popular that it spawned its own animated series which premiered on Paramount+ in 2024 to decent reviews.
Announced and shadow-dropped in October 2023, may just be one of the most elaborate attempts to remaster a game that the industry has ever seen. The entirety of is included in the package alongside a plethora of additional features like a revamped UI, realistic lighting achieved with Unreal Engine 5, a new map system, and even more creatures to hunt, making it the definitive version of the game. Despite this, the game has largely received mixed reviews from the community.
has earned praise for taking the systems of and making them both more accessible for newcomers and tweaking its presentation to look better than ever. However, many players have also criticized the game as a paid product given Studio Wildcard initially promised that it would be a free upgrade. This, alongside the fact that the game's performance on PC wasn't up to snuff at launch, has left a bad taste in fans' mouths.
